Structured_descriptionConcise_descriptiontba-8 encodes a member of the alpha tubulin family with high similarity to the human tubulin alpha-6 chain; expressed in some neurons with occasional expression in the hypodermis.Paper_evidenceWBPaper00002319

Automated_descriptionPredicted to enable GTP binding activity. Predicted to be a structural constituent of cytoskeleton. Predicted to be involved in microtubule cytoskeleton organization and mitotic cell cycle. Predicted to be located in cytoplasm and microtubule. Expressed in germ line; posterior lateral ganglion; retrovesicular ganglion; seam cell; and ventral cord neurons.Paper_evidenceWBPaper00065943
